Got a response from Fathom Events after I submitted my complaint... they blame DCI's poor sound quality.

I got this today

Michael,

Thank you for your email! We apologize for the lighting issue you described below and will touch base with this theatre to find out what happened in efforts to make sure it doesn’t happen again as well as find out why ticket prices were different for the event. Regarding the actual sound quality, this is a part of the content we received from DCI and, although it is “up-converted” to the theatre audio system, the content does contain coverage of past events, which results in the sound quality you experienced.

We appreciate your feedback and strive to provide the highest quality events to our patrons, please know that we do our absolute best with the content we receive.
